Bring Your Public Practice Foundation In-House and Help Build a Global Tax Function
This is an exciting opportunity for an experienced tax professional to join one of Canada's fastest-growing global technology companies and play a key role in the continued development of its in-house tax function.
We are particularly interested in tax professionals who have developed a strong technical foundation within Big Four or large national public practice and subsequently gained hands-on experience within a complex corporate or multinational environment.
Reporting directly to the VP, Tax, this is a hands-on Senior Manager position combining corporate tax compliance, tax accounting and provisions with international tax, business partnering, process improvement and strategic projects.
While the position offers significant exposure to senior leadership and complex global tax matters, this is not a role focused solely on reviewing the work of others or managing external advisors. The successful candidate will remain actively involved in the underlying technical work, including tax provisions, compliance, detailed working papers, technical analysis and documentation.

What You'll Be Doing
Corporate Tax Compliance & Risk Management
- Support and oversee corporate income tax compliance across multiple entities and jurisdictions.
- Remain actively involved in the preparation and review of tax returns, calculations, supporting schedules and detailed tax working papers.
- Coordinate with external tax advisors while retaining meaningful internal ownership of tax matters.
- Support tax audits, regulatory inquiries and information requests.
- Research and analyze technical tax issues and clearly document conclusions.
- Monitor changes in Canadian and international tax legislation and assess potential implications for the business.
- Strengthen tax governance, documentation, processes and internal controls.
Tax Accounting & Financial Reporting
- Take a hands-on role in the preparation and review of quarterly and annual income tax provisions.
- Support tax accounting and financial reporting requirements under ASC 740 / US GAAP.
- Prepare and improve detailed tax provision working papers, reconciliations and supporting documentation.
- Analyze current and deferred tax positions and support the resolution of complex tax accounting matters.
- Support executive reporting and tax risk assessments.
- Help build scalable tax accounting and reporting processes capable of supporting an increasingly complex global organization.
International Tax & Business Partnering
- Support international tax matters across a growing multinational business.
- Assist with transfer pricing and intercompany tax considerations.
- Partner with Finance, Legal, Product, Engineering, Sales, HR and other teams on the tax implications of business initiatives.
- Support international expansion and evolving global tax requirements.
- Assist with R&D; tax incentives across relevant jurisdictions.
- Support acquisitions, tax due diligence and post-acquisition integration.
- Contribute to emerging global tax matters and regulatory developments.

What We're Looking For
- CPA designation or international equivalent.
- Approximately 8+ years of progressive tax experience.
- Strong foundational training from Big Four or a large national public accounting firm.
- In-house tax experience within a large, complex or multinational organization is strongly preferred.
- Strong Canadian corporate income tax knowledge.
- Recent hands-on experience with corporate tax compliance, income tax provisions and detailed tax working papers.
- Experience preparing and/or taking significant ownership of quarterly and annual income tax provisions.
- Strong tax accounting knowledge.
- Ability to research technical tax issues, develop an appropriate position and clearly document conclusions.
- Experience working across multiple entities and/or jurisdictions.
- Experience coordinating with external tax advisors while maintaining meaningful internal ownership.
- Excellent communication and stakeholder-management skills.
- Strong project-management and organizational capabilities.
- Comfortable working independently within a quick-paced and evolving environment.
Experience That Would Be Particularly Valuable
- ASC 740 / US GAAP income tax accounting.
- U.S. corporate tax exposure.
- International tax.
- Transfer pricing.
- Pillar Two / GloBE.
- EIFEL.
- Indirect tax, including GST/HST, sales tax and VAT.
- R&D; / SR&ED; or other tax incentives.
- M&A; tax due diligence and post-acquisition integration.
- Public-company reporting or IPO readiness.
- Tax technology, systems, automation or AI-enabled tax processes.
- Technology or SaaS industry experience.
Technology-sector experience would certainly be beneficial, but it is not essential. The hiring team is more interested in finding someone with the right technical foundation, hands-on capability, industry mindset and desire to help build and improve a growing global tax function.
